Dr. Jun Wang is a pathologist practicing in Loma Linda, CA. Dr. Wang is a doctor who specializes in the study of bodily fluids and tissues. As a pathologist, Dr. Wang can help your primary care doctor make a diagnosis about your medical condition. Dr. Wang may perform a tissue biopsy to determine if a patient has cancer, practice genetic testing, and complete a number of laboratory examinations. Pathologists can also perform autopsies which can determine a persons cause of death and gain information about genetic progression of a disease.
